At present, enterprise office is generally faced with the pain point of "multiple systems but no interconnection": growing enterprises often deploy seven or eight sets of systems such as CRM, ERP and OA, and rely entirely on employees as "human routers" — manually copying data across systems to assemble forms, manually modifying orders across systems, and inconsistent statistical calibers of data output from multiple departments. These bottlenecks are not caused by insufficient model capabilities, but by the lack of a layer that connects methods, execution, responsibilities and organizational memory into a complete link: whether AI can enter existing systems, complete tasks safely and controllably, and return results to people. KuWork is built exactly for this layer — the AI Work Layer for enterprises, which enables trainable organizational methods, governable AI collaboration and compoundable enterprise capabilities, and trains the work methods of enterprise employees into reusable AI workforce.
Different from traditional AI assistants or development platforms, the technological and product innovations of KuWork center on the precipitation of enterprise organizational capabilities. Users start with real tasks: after an employee completes only one work demonstration, KuWork can extract the steps, rules, tools, acceptance standards and manual review points from it, to generate a governable organizational Skill. A Skill is not a simple prompt, but a "work charter" that defines how to do a task, to what standard, and what cannot be done. Meanwhile, it supports multiple Agents to share task status, and manual review of key nodes. The results and feedback of each execution will be precipitated as organizational memory, forming a closed loop of "task execution - review and calibration - memory precipitation - capability enhancement", turning every AI task of the enterprise into the accumulation of organizational assets, rather than a one-off disposable output.
KuWork supports two deployment methods: SaaS and private deployment, which can connect to foundation models and various existing systems of enterprises. Meanwhile, Skills and organizational memory are stored independently of the underlying model, so model replacement will not affect the continuous precipitation of the enterprise's context, methods and governance capabilities, solving the core pain point in current AI implementation that "AI output grows but enterprise capabilities do not accumulate". KuWork is currently in the internal test stage, where original long-term cooperative clients are invited to experience the product, with focus on verifying the task success rate, completion cycle and the reduction of manual links in benchmark scenarios. The first batch of verification focuses on two typical scenarios with complex collaboration and many manual links: manufacturing production scheduling and cross-border e-commerce order modification. In the manufacturing production scheduling collaboration scenario, the goal is to convert the original production scheduling process that requires manually copying data and assembling forms across four systems including ERP, MES, WMS and CRM, into a collaborative delivery mode where KuWork automatically pulls data, assembles and merges data according to rules, and humans conduct the final review. For cross-border e-commerce order modification, the goal is to convert the link that requires manual synchronization of multiple systems when a customer modifies an order, into automatic synchronization of multiple systems after one single modification, with humans only checking the results. After the internal test is completed, quantifiable comparison indicators of task cycle and error rate will be formed to verify the implementation path of "AI promotes work, and humans are responsible for judgment".
In terms of business model, KuWork adopts a three-tier progressive logic: the first tier is priced aligned with "workload", charging based on the number of tasks promoted by AI and the output results, which is different from the traditional SaaS seat-based charging, so that enterprises only pay for actual value. The second tier realizes high user retention relying on the precipitation of skill assets: the longer an enterprise uses the product, the more exclusive work methods it accumulates, and the higher the migration cost will be. The third tier follows the path of "single scenario verification - skill precipitation and reuse - full organization expansion", and the customer unit price increases naturally as value is delivered.
